This video offers an in-depth review of the Cadex Defence Kraken Multi-Caliber Rifle System. The presenter, Gary Melton, a former U.S. Army Special Forces Green Beret and owner of Paramount Tactical Solutions, details the rifle's features, customization options, and accessories. The review includes extensive long-range and accuracy testing with both 6.5 Creedmoor and .300 PRC calibers, demonstrating the process of changing calibers and barrels. The video also touches on Paramount Tactical Solutions' training programs and their team of Special Operations veterans.

This video provides a direct comparison between the .308 Winchester and 6.5 Creedmoor cartridges, aiming to settle the debate on which is superior for accuracy and downrange performance. The creator argues that 6.5 Creedmoor's better ballistic coefficient and muzzle velocity make it the dominant choice, particularly in wind. The comparison utilizes data from three different rifle models, each chambered in both calibers, including a Cadex Seven Stars Pro (rechambered to 6.5 Creedmoor), a Ruger American, and a Remington 783. This video offers a beginner-friendly guide to night vision (NVG) setup and usage, aimed at those considering entering the field. It covers essential tips and demonstrates a practical kit configuration. The presenter, a first-time NVG user, highlights the Low Light Innovations LLUL-21 dual-tube NVGs, emphasizing their lightweight design, auto-gain, and adjustable lenses, ideal for law enforcement and civilian applications. The setup features a Cadex defense helmet mount on a Team Wendy Exfil Ballistic helmet and an external battery pack for balance. The firearm components include a Sons of Liberty Gun Works M4-89 rifle with a Steiner DBal A3 and HRT AWLS weapon light, an EOTech EXPS3-0 on a Unity Riser, and a Shadow Systems DR920L pistol with a Trijicon RMR and Streamlight TLR-1HL. The video stresses the importance of white light for domestic operations and aims to provide insight into NVG usage and IR laser setup for both novice and experienced users.
